Transaction a3191fa08623136990273dffd3b68dc1417125b67eeee757eab26a4348f9b030
1 Input
1 Output
-
a3191fa08623136990273dffd3b68dc1417125b67eeee757eab26a4348f9b030:0
- value
- 75593
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8cba7fbb5afcd45dd0623871533c7735e05ab56b OP_EQUAL
- address
- 3EX7waGZjncMyb9a4A92SCBKBpXQ5kuTjX